Council supports Local Businesses through the creation of Recover Richmond Hill Task Force
Posted on Wednesday, April 22, 2020 06:00 PM
Task force will include local business leaders and focus on economic recovery
RICHMOND HILL – Richmond Hill is looking to accelerate economic recovery to address the downturn and uncertainty created by COVID-19. A key step is Council’s creation of the Recover Richmond Hill Task Force at its online April 22 meeting. Richmond Hill Launches Hotline for Reporting COVID-19 Complaints
Posted on Friday, April 17, 2020 11:00 AM
RICHMOND HILL – In response to community concerns, the City has launched a dedicated phone number and email to receive tips about businesses and residents violating provincial COVID-19 orders and municipal closures.
Richmond Hill by-law officers have already investigated more than 140 reported incidences of non-essential workplaces that are still operating, individuals using closed playgrounds or sports fields, and residents gathering in large groups.

Richmond Hill Asks for Residents’ Help to Keep Community Safe
Posted on Thursday, April 02, 2020 11:45 AM
Richmond Hill Asks for Residents’ Help to Keep Community SafeExtends closures and provides waste collection safety guidelines
RICHMOND HILL – In a continued effort to protect the community and stop the spread of COVID-19, the City has extended the closure of facilities to the public until May 31 and cancelled all City-led and Council festivals and events until June 30.
